Soundgarden are among the list of artists scheduled to perform at President Obama’s Inauguration Ball on Monday.
The Seattle rockers will be joined at the Washington Convention Center by Alicia Keys, Black Violin, Brad Paisley, Far East Movement, FUN., members of the Glee cast, John Legend, Katy Perry, Maná, Smokey Robinson, Stevie Wonder and Usher; the acts will perform on multiple stages.
D-Nice will DJ the event, which will be a unified celebration for Americans from across the country, bringing together members of the public, grassroots volunteers, local community leaders and supporters, various organizations, and local and state elected leaders.
Soundgarden’s Chris Cornell will be doing double-duty on Monday, as he will also perform at the Commander-in-Chief’s Ball, where President Obama and Vice President Biden will honor the brave men and women of our country’s armed forces and their families. Alicia Keys, Brad Paisley, Jamie Foxx, Jennifer Hudson and Marc Anthony will perform, while Dan Moose will DJ the event.
Tickets to the Commander-in-Chief ’s Ball are being provided free of charge by the PIC to all invited guests, who include active duty and reserve military, Medal of Honor recipients, and Wounded Warriors and their spouses.
In support of their new album, “King Animal”, Soundgarden kicked off their North American tour in New York this week.
